From mboxrd@z Thu Jan 1 00:00:00 1970 X-Spam-Checker-Version: SpamAssassin 3.4.4 (2020-01-24) on polar.synack.me X-Spam-Level: X-Spam-Status: No, score=-1.3 required=5.0 tests=BAYES_00,INVALID_MSGID autolearn=no autolearn_force=no version=3.4.4 X-Google-Language: ENGLISH,ASCII-7-bit X-Google-Thread: 103376,13f9967aa564a834 X-Google-Attributes: gid103376,public From: dewar@merv.cs.nyu.edu (Robert Dewar) Subject: Re: VMS to Unix (was: Is there a Fortran to Ada translator) Date: 1997/02/17 Message-ID: #1/1 X-Deja-AN: 219391015 References: <9702121335.AA05019@most> <5e77gh$qp4$1@salyko.cube.net> Organization: New York University Newsgroups: comp.lang.ada Date: 1997-02-17T00:00:00+00:00 List-Id: Oliver asks <> This would introduce nasty implementation dependencies, since of course in different implementations the base types would differ, so on one implementation you might be able to assign Fortran_Integer to Integer without a conversion and on another you would not be able to. The extra complication introduced by the derived types is precisely what is needed to ensure proper portability, which is the whole idea of this interface package.